Place Value 
The students will create a place value drawing . The student will write their number in Standard Form, Expanded Form, and Word Form.

Place-Value Drawing

excellent

Student place-value drawing includes one number in the thousand place with each place-value position labled correctly.
good

Student place-value drawing includes one number in the Thousand place with three out of the four place-value positions labled correctly.
fair

Student place-value drawing includes one number in the Thousand place with two out of the four place-value positions labled correctly.
poor

Student place-value drawing one number in the thousand place and no other place-value positions labled correctly.
Standard Form

excellent

All numbers included in standard form.
good

Three numbers were included in standard form.
fair

Two numbers were included in standard form.
poor

No numbers were included in standard form.
Expanded Form

excellent

All numbers were written in expanded form correctly.
good

Three numbers were written correctly in expanded form. There were some mistakes in writting in expanded form.
fair

Two numbers were written correctly in expanded form . There were some mistakes in writing in expanded form.
poor

No numbers were written in correctly in expanded form. There were several mistakes in writing in expanded form.
Word Form

excellent

All numbers were written in word form correctly.
good

At least three numbers were written correctly in word form. There were some mistakes in writting in word form.
fair

At least two numbers were written correctly in word form. There were some mistakes in writing in word form.
poor

Only one or no numbers were written correctly in word form. There were several mistakes in writing in word form.
Organization/Neatness

excellent

The overall drawing was very neat. (It includes: Standard Form, Expanded Form, Word Form, etc.)
good

All the forms were written but the overall drawing was messy.
fair

Only some of the forms were written. Drawning was hard to understand.
poor

There were no form. Drawing was hard to understand.
